Skip to main content

dBase Pertemuan ke-12 (Praktek Create Table & Tampilan dengan PHP)

 

 



Berikut text yang dipelajari pada video diatas (silakan copy paste untuk praktek):


https://ibi-k57.wihandar.my.id/mysql/

Silakan menggunakan username dan password yang sudah diberikan. 

Username: wihx6572_kosgoro

password : kosgoro


Script membuat tabel sales:

======== start ====

CREATE TABLE sales (

  id_transaksi int(11) NOT NULL AUTO_INCREMENT,

  id_produk int(11) NOT NULL,

  tgl_transaksi date NOT NULL,

  kuantitas tinyint(4) NOT NULL,

  harga int(11) NOT NULL,

  id_pelanggan int(11) NOT NULL,

  PRIMARY KEY (id_transaksi),

  KEY id_produk (id_produk)

) ;

== end ===


Script meng-input data pada tabel sales


=== start==

INSERT INTO sales (id_transaksi, id_produk, tgl_transaksi, kuantitas, harga, id_pelanggan) 

VALUES (1, 100, '2016-09-20', 8, 265000, 1),

(2, 100, '2016-10-11', 3, 270000, 2),

(3, 101, '2016-08-17', 8, 250000, 2),

(4, 101, '2016-08-24', 12, 380000, 2),

(5, 101, '2016-05-10', 12, 250000, 1),

(6, 101, '2016-05-04', 11, 375000, 1),

(7, 101, '2016-07-15', 3, 265000, 1),

(8, 100, '2016-05-19', 4, 250000, 1),

(9, 101, '2016-06-17', 12, 255000, 2),

(10, 100, '2016-09-11', 12, 280000, 1);

===end ===


file baca.php

=== start ==

<?php

$db_host = 'localhost'; // Nama Server

$db_user = 'wihx6572_kosgoro'; // Isi menggunakan nama user anda

$db_pass = 'kosgoro'; // isi dengan nama password anda

$db_name = 'wihx6572_kosgoro'; // Nama Database sama dengan db_user


$conn = mysqli_connect($db_host, $db_user, $db_pass, $db_name);

if (!$conn) {

die ('Gagal terhubung MySQL: ' . mysqli_connect_error());

}


$sql = 'SELECT id_produk, tgl_transaksi, harga, kuantitas 

FROM sales';

$query = mysqli_query($conn, $sql);


if (!$query) {

die ('SQL Error: ' . mysqli_error($conn));

}


echo '<table>

<thead>

<tr>

<th>ID PRODUK</th>

<th>TGL TRANSAKSI</th>

<th>HARGA</th>

<th>KUANTITAS</th>

</tr>

</thead>

<tbody>';

while ($row = mysqli_fetch_array($query))

{

echo '<tr>

<td>'.$row['id_produk'].'</td>

<td>'.$row['tgl_transaksi'].'</td>

<td>'.number_format($row['harga'], 0, ',', '.').'</td>

<td class="right">'.$row['kuantitas'].'</td>

</tr>';

}

echo '

</tbody>

</table>';


// Hasil

mysqli_free_result($query);


// Diskonek MySQL

mysqli_close($conn);


===end===

Berikut untuk mengupload file PHP yang sudah anda buat


http://wihandar.my.id/upload/

username: kosgoro

password: kosgoro@2021



https://wihandar.my.id/kosgoro/coba.php


Silakan Anda bebas mencoba-coba praktekan mysql dan php menggunakan hosting wihandar.my.id diatas. Tidak terbatas hanya pada materi diatas. Anda bisa mencari referensi di internet.








Comments

Popular posts from this blog

OSI LAYER: PENGERTIAN, FUNGSI DAN CARA KERJA 7 LAPISAN OSI

  Pengertian OSI Layer  – Ketika menggunakan  e-mail , pernahkah Anda berpikir tentang bagaimana isi  e-mail  tersebut dapat berpindah dari satu perangkat ke perangkat lain? Hanya dengan sekali klik, beberapa saat kemudian Anda dapat mengirim informasi kepada seseorang nun jauh di sana. Informasi tersebut sampai kepada penerima  e-mail  dalam bentuk yang sama. Dan tahukah Anda kalau sebenarnya hal tersebut membutuhkan proses cukup panjang?. Nah, kali ini Anda dapat mengetahui bagaimana itu terjadi dengan mempelajari cara kerja OSI Layer. Pengertian OSI Layer Setiap komputer dalam jaringan memiliki cara berkomunikasinya masing-masing. Komputer bermerek A memiliki bahasa sendiri, dan hanya bisa berkomunikasi dengan perangkat lain yang bermerek sama. Hal tersebut juga terjadi pada sistem jaringan. Di mana pertukaran informasi antar jaringan tidak bisa terjalin dengan baik. Sementara tentu saja proses komunikasi dibutuhkan tidak hanya oleh komputer dalam s...

DBase Lanjutan 4 (WHERE, AND, OR and NOT, ORDER by, NULL, UPDATE, DELETE)

  WHERE :   https://www.w3schools.com/mysql/mysql_where.asp AND, OR , NOT :  https://www.w3schools.com/mysql/mysql_and_or.asp ORDER by :  https://www.w3schools.com/mysql/mysql_orderby.asp NULL :  https://www.w3schools.com/mysql/mysql_null_values.asp UPDATE ;  https://www.w3schools.com/mysql/mysql_update.asp DELETE :  https://www.w3schools.com/mysql/mysql_delete.asp Kerjakan QUIZ Berikut: https://docs.google.com/forms/d/e/1FAIpQLSdqohEh0pLez9HT9SowDSg48I11qpg95lruUKZGTOWfKC6iuw/viewform

Materi Rujukan MK DBase Fundamental 1

Download Materi Rujukan: 1. Database Systems: The complete Book, Hector, Jeffrey, Jennifer, Penerbit Prentice Hall->   KLIK DISINI 2. DATABASE SYSTEM, Thomas Conolly, Carolyn Begg, Penerbit Addison Wesley ->  KLIK DISINI 3. Ramakrishnan, Raghu, ehrke, Johannes, 2003, Database Management Systems, Third Edition, New York: The McGrawHill Companies, Inc.   KLIK DISINI 4. Howe, David; Data analysis for Database Design, third Edition, Butterworth-Heineman, 2001   KLIK DISINI